When the Electra jailbreak for iOS 11 introduced (a modern alternative to Cydia), Packix was one of the first third-party repos pre-installed by default. Millions of users jailbreaking with Electra, Chimera, and Odyssey saw Packix right out of the box. This gave it an enormous user base almost overnight. Repo.packix.com

Founded by developer Andrew Wiik, Packix revolutionized how developers sold and managed their work. Before its archival, it was the largest centralized repository, hosting over at its peak. It simplified the experience for users by integrating web apps for management and supporting modern package managers like Sileo and Zebra.
